Keyword Research: Targeting the Right Terms for Your Pest Control Business

Identifying the right keywords is a critical step in SEO that acts much like choosing the correct bait for pest control—it attracts the right kind of visitors to your website. For a pest control business, conducting thorough keyword research means finding terms and phrases that potential customers are using to search for your services.

One effective tool for this task is Google Keyword Planner. This free tool helps you discover keywords related to your business and provides data on how often these terms are searched and how competitive they are. 

This information is crucial as it helps you select keywords that are relevant, but not so competitive that you have little chance of ranking well.

To begin, brainstorm a list of basic keywords that describe your services, such as "pest control", "termite inspection" or "rat exterminator". Enter these terms into Google Keyword Planner to uncover related keywords. 

For example, entering "pest control" might reveal related searches like "affordable pest control services" or "eco-friendly pest control near me."

Choose keywords based on a balance of high search volume (many people are searching for this term) and relevance (the keyword closely relates to what you offer). 

For instance, if you specialize in organic pest control methods, a keyword like "non-toxic pest control" might be both relevant and popular enough to target.

By selecting the right keywords, you ensure that your SEO efforts are focused not just on attracting more traffic, but on attracting the right kind of traffic that is likely to convert into bookings and sales.

Optimizing Website Content: Engaging Readers and Search Engines

Creating content that appeals to both your readers and search engines is a balancing act, similar to using just the right amount of pesticide — too little won't be effective, and too much can be harmful. 

Here’s how to optimize your pest control website content to engage readers and enhance your SEO performance.

Use Headings and Subheadings

Just as clear signage helps navigate a complex building, headings and subheadings guide readers through your content and help search engines understand the structure of your pages. 

Use H1, H2, and H3 tags to organize your content effectively. For example, your main service page might use an H1 tag for "Pest Control Services", with H2 tags for subcategories like "Insect Extermination" and "Rodent Removal".

Strategic Keyword Placement

Incorporate your selected keywords naturally into your content, especially in key areas such as the title, headings, the first paragraph, and the conclusion. 

However, avoid overstuffing your text with keywords, which can lead to a penalty from search engines and detract from the reader’s experience. 

Remember, your website is made for people, not for a system, so remember to optimize their content to be useful and meaningful for your local population, for example.

Create Valuable Content

Your content should not only incorporate keywords, but also provide real value to your audience. 

For instance, a blog post titled "5 Signs You Might Have a Termite Problem" should offer genuine advice that positions your company as a knowledgeable and trustworthy resource. 

Include actionable tips, preventative measures, and how your services can resolve their issues. These things are the simple basis of a Content SEO Strategy, so don’t neglect it.

Optimize for Readability

Ensure your content is easy to read by breaking up text with bullet points, numbered lists, and short paragraphs. This makes the content more digestible for readers and helps keep them engaged longer on your page.

Local SEO Strategies: Capturing Your Community Market

For pest control services, local SEO is crucial because most customers are searching for solutions within their immediate geographical area. 

Enhancing your local SEO ensures that your business appears when nearby residents need your services the most. To ensure this, there are some things that you can do:

1. Optimize Your Google My Business Listing: This is a fundamental step in local SEO. Ensure your Google My Business (GMB) profile is complete and accurate, including your business name, address, phone number, and hours of operation.

Additionally, categorize your business accurately — in this case, as a pest control service. Upload high-quality photos of your team, your office, or your work in action. These elements make your listing more appealing and trustworthy to potential customers.

2. Utilize Local Keywords: Incorporate location-based keywords into your website content, such as the city or neighborhood where you operate. 

For example, instead of just using “pest control services”, use “pest control services in [City Name]” or “[Neighborhood Name] pest exterminators”. This helps search engines understand where your services are relevant, boosting your visibility in local search results.

3. Gather and Manage Customer Reviews: Positive reviews significantly impact local SEO rankings as well as customer trust. Encourage satisfied customers to leave a review on your GMB listing or other relevant online platforms. 

Actively respond to reviews, both positive and negative, to show that you value customer feedback and are committed to improving service quality.

By focusing on these local SEO strategies, your pest control business can enhance its visibility and appeal to the community it serves, ultimately driving more local traffic and increasing bookings.

Building Links: Strengthening Your SEO Through Strategic Partnerships

Backlinks — links from other websites to your own — are among the most influential factors in SEO. 

Think of each backlink as a vote of confidence in the eyes of search engines; the more votes you have from reputable sites, the more trustworthy your site appears, which can improve your search rankings.

Let’s see some ways to gain some links from your community.

Understand the Importance of Quality Backlinks

Not all backlinks are created equal. Links from high-authority, relevant websites have a much greater impact on your SEO than links from low-quality or irrelevant sites. 

It’s like getting a recommendation from a respected figure in your community versus someone less known. 

Forge Partnerships with Local Businesses

One effective way to build quality backlinks is by partnering with other local businesses. 

For example, if you provide eco-friendly pest control, you could partner with local environmental organizations or home improvement businesses. 

You might exchange guest blog posts, share each other’s content, or sponsor community events together. These are some simple ways to get some links from your local authority.

Engage in Community Involvement

Participating in or sponsoring community events can also lead to valuable backlinks.

For instance, if you sponsor a local charity run or a community fair, these events often have websites where they list their sponsors with links to their websites.

This not only aids your SEO, but also boosts your local presence and reputation.

Create Link-Worthy Content

Develop content that other websites would want to link to, such as informative articles, guides, or infographics about pest control. 

This content can naturally attract backlinks from bloggers, journalists, or businesses within your industry.

By focusing on these strategies, you can build a robust profile of backlinks that will support your SEO efforts, helping to elevate your visibility and credibility online.

Mobile Optimization: Ensuring Accessibility Anywhere, Anytime

Having a mobile-friendly website is not just an advantage—it’s a necessity. The surge in mobile device usage has shifted the way consumers search for and interact with online content, including services like pest control. 

Mobile optimization is crucial for reaching potential customers effectively and improving your site’s SEO. Let’s know more about the importance of the mobile optimization!

Importance of Mobile-Friendliness

Mobile devices account for over half of web traffic globally. People often reach for their smartphones to quickly solve a problem or find a local service. 

If your pest control website isn’t optimized for mobile, you risk losing potential customers who might find your site difficult to navigate, slow to load, or hard to read on smaller screens.

Impact on SEO

Search engines like Google prioritize mobile-friendly websites in their rankings, particularly for searches made on mobile devices. 

This means that mobile optimization can significantly influence where your website appears in search results. Google uses mobile-first indexing, meaning it predominantly uses the mobile version of the content for indexing and ranking.

Enhancing Mobile Usability

To ensure your website is mobile-friendly, focus on responsive design, which automatically adjusts content to fit the screen size and orientation of the device being used. 

Also, streamline your site’s navigation to make it easy for mobile users to find what they need, optimize images to load quickly on mobile, and use large, readable fonts.

Monitoring SEO Performance: Using Tools to Track Success

Effective SEO is not a set-and-forget process; it requires ongoing monitoring and adjustment. 

To ensure your pest control website continues to perform well in search results and attract potential customers, you'll need to use tools designed to track your SEO performance. 

Two of the most powerful and free tools available are Google Analytics and Google Search Console.

Google Analytics

This tool is essential for understanding how visitors interact with your website. Google Analytics provides detailed data on website traffic, user behavior, and engagement metrics such as session duration, pages per session, and bounce rate.

By analyzing this data, you can identify which pages are most popular, where your traffic is coming from, and how users navigate through your site. 

This information is invaluable for refining your content and SEO strategies to better meet the needs of your audience.

Google Search Console

While Google Analytics focuses on user behavior, Google Search Console helps you understand your site’s presence in Google search results. 

It shows which queries bring users to your site, how high you rank for those queries, and how often people click through to your site. It also alerts you to any issues that might affect your site’s performance, such as crawl errors or security issues.

Using these tools together provides a comprehensive view of both the health of your website and its performance in search results. 

Regularly reviewing these insights allows you to make informed decisions, adapting your strategies to improve your site’s visibility and effectiveness in attracting potential clients.
